(Photo by Surachai Piragsa)BURI RAM: Eight people were injured - five seriously - when five motorcycles slammed into a pick-up truck in front of a petrol station in Muang district late Saturday night. Five of about ten motorcycles speeding down the Buri Ram-Satuk road crashed into an Isuzu pick-up truck that cut in front of them while making a sudden right into a PTT petrol station. Five of them were seriously wounded and required cardiopulmonary resuscitation. All of the eight wounded were admitted to Buri Ram Hospital.
